This plant will arrive planted into a plastic … WebApr 13, 2024 · The scientific name for the prayer plant is Maranta leuconeura, and it's known for its unique ability to fold its leaves up at night, as if in prayer. This is due to a specialized joint called the pulvinus, which is located at the base of each leaf.

Also knows as shamrock, love plant, or sorrel, ornamental Oxalis features a low-growing, spreading habit with trifoliate leaves that range from purple to green, including some bicolor and variegated varieties. With over 550 species, oxalis is native to many parts of the world. Maranta Leuconeura, commonly known as a prayer plant, is an ornamental tropical plant native … santanderbank.com online bankingWebJul 20, 2024 · Calathea orbifolia: This species features silver-green stripes on its large leaves. Calathea makoyana: Commonly known as the peacock plant, this species features leaves of dark green, cream, purple, and pink hues with red stems.
